Overall dimensions and technical information are provided solely for informative purposes and may be modified without notice Proportional technology Series WPR 2 s 2 | 208 Series WPR • Output pressure up to 18 bar • Flow rate up to 4000Nl/min • There are versions available with or without proportional integration • Proportional Integrated versions available with Analogue/Digital, CANopen® , IO-Link, EtherCAT®, PROFINET IO RT and EtherNet/IP interface • IN / OUT connections, main regulator G1/2" • EXH connection, main regulator G1/4" • IN connection, pilot regulator M5 • Versions available with external feedback WPR proportional piloting pressure regulators are designed to be able to provide an output pressure value P2 up to 18 bar and are available with the integrated pilot proportional pressure regulator or with an M5 connection for pneumatic proportional remote piloting. The main regulator and pilot regulator maintain separate supplies, while the main regulator has a maximum inlet pressure of 20 bar the proportional pilot regulator maintains the inlet pressure of 10 bar. The ratio of pilot pressure to outlet pressure is between 1:1 and 1:2 depending on the inlet pressure and pilot pressure. The device is made with G1/2" IN/OUT main connections and provides a nominal flow rate of 4.000 Nl/min. Product presentation and applications WPR proportional regulators (Wide Pressure Range) are ideal for all applications where there is a need to use a low-pressure (0-9 bar) reference signal resulting in a high-pressure (0-18 bar) P2 output. The devices have separate pneumatic supplies for the main regulator and the integrated pilot proportional regulator. The main regulator features G1/2" IN/OUT connections and a G1/4" EXH drain connection. The input connection of the integrated pilot proportional regulator is M5 ported. An external feedback version is available an option that allows the P2 pressure signal to be taken from a remote point rather than directly from the usage connection. This function is usually used when the end user is not near to the devices. At the top is located the management electronics or the connection for remote piloting. The fixing takes place through the use of a special fixing bracket.
